What is the spiritual meaning of Aquamarine? Throughout history, many civilizations have used Aquamarine as a protective or lucky charm. When translated, Aquamarine means “water of the sea”. Its name comes from Latin, and it was named by Roman fishermen. Because it’s part of a Beryl family of minerals, aquamarine is found in beautiful, symmetrical hexagonal shapes, with either a light, almost transparent blue color, or a deep rich blue color like the sea.įormed into the deep layers of Mother Earth, most commonly around mountains, Aquamarine is formed when magma heats up mineral rocks called pegmatite.
